Tiger Woods Returns to Switzerland for Rehab After Brief Florida Visit

Following a brief visit to Florida, Tiger Woods has returned to Switzerland to continue his rehabilitation. Reports indicate that Woods’ Gulfstream V private jet took off from Witham Field in Stuart, Florida, on a Saturday evening and landed in Switzerland the following day.
Tiger Woods’ Florida Journey
Woods was seen arriving at Palm Beach International Airport on May 13. This visit led many to speculate that he had completed his rehabilitation treatment overseas. However, his subsequent return to Switzerland suggests that he is still focusing on his recovery.
Personal Challenges
The timing of Woods’ Florida trip coincides with significant challenges in his personal life. His girlfriend, Vanessa Trump, recently announced her breast cancer diagnosis. On social media, she expressed her appreciation for Woods, calling him her “strength” during this difficult time.
Recent Developments in Woods’ Life
- Woods has been dating Vanessa Trump since March 2025.
- In March 2026, he was involved in a car accident on Jupiter Island, Florida.
- The accident resulted in two misdemeanor charges related to DUI and refusal to take a urine test.
After the incident, Woods decided to step away from golf to focus on his health and seek treatment. He was granted permission to travel for inpatient therapy on April 1. Notably, Woods has not participated in competitive golf since the 2024 Open Championship.
